There is no physical inch. Since 1959 the inch has been defined as exactly 0.0254 metres, which makes every imperial length a derived metric unit. The countries that resisted the metric system most successfully still measure everything with it, one layer down.

What the Units Actually Are

The metre was originally one ten-millionth of the distance from the equator to the North Pole, measured along a meridian through Paris. That definition was replaced by a platinum bar, then by a wavelength of krypton-86 light, and since 1983 by the distance light travels in a vacuum in 1/299,792,458 of a second.

That last definition is worth pausing on: it fixes the speed of light as exact and derives the metre from it. The speed of light is no longer measured, it is defined, and the metre floats on top of it.

The International Yard and Pound Agreement of 1959 then pinned the imperial system to the metric one. The yard became exactly 0.9144 metres, which makes the foot exactly 0.3048 metres and the inch exactly 25.4 millimetres. Before that agreement, the American and British inches differed by a fraction of a micron, enough to matter for precision engineering and not for anything else.

Exact Conversions Worth Knowing

Every figure in the middle column is exact by definition, not rounded.

UnitExactlyUseful approximation
1 inch25.4 mmRoughly 2.5 cm
1 foot0.3048 mAbout 30 cm
1 yard0.9144 mSlightly under a metre
1 mile1,609.344 mAbout 1.6 km
1 nautical mile1,852 mOne minute of latitude
1 metre1.0936133 ydAbout 3 feet 3 inches
1 kilometre0.62137119 miRoughly 5/8 of a mile
1 centimetre0.393700787 inA bit under 0.4 inches

The unit mismatch that lost a Mars orbiter

In 1999 NASA lost the Mars Climate Orbiter, a 125 million dollar spacecraft, because one team supplied thruster impulse figures in pound-force seconds while the receiving software expected newton-seconds. The trajectory was wrong by enough to put the craft into the atmosphere. Nobody made an arithmetic error; the units were simply never checked at the interface.

The Foot That Was Slightly Different Until 2023

For sixty years the United States maintained two feet. The international foot of exactly 0.3048 metres, and the US survey foot of 1200/3937 metres, which is longer by about two parts per million.

Two parts per million sounds negligible and is, over the length of a room. Over the width of a state it is not. Across 100 kilometres the two definitions differ by about 20 centimetres, which is enough to move a property boundary or misplace a benchmark in a geodetic survey.

The survey foot survived because changing it would have invalidated a century of land records. NIST and NOAA finally retired it at the end of 2022, and since 1 January 2023 the international foot is the only legal foot in the United States. Older survey data still carries the previous definition, so anyone working with historical coordinates needs to know which foot a dataset was recorded in.

Where Conversions Go Wrong

The arithmetic is trivial. The mistakes come from everything around it.

1

Rounding too early

Convert, round to two decimals, then convert again and the error compounds. Carry full precision through every intermediate step and round only when you display the final number.

2

Treating approximations as exact

One inch is 2.54 cm exactly, but one mile is 1.609344 km, not 1.6. Using the shortcut over a marathon distance puts you out by more than 300 metres.

3

Confusing area and volume scaling

A square foot is not 0.3048 square metres, it is 0.3048², about 0.0929. A cubic foot is 0.3048³. Converting an area with a linear factor is one of the most common spreadsheet errors.

4

Mixing up nautical and statute miles

They differ by about 15 percent. A nautical mile is one minute of latitude, which is why it persists in aviation and shipping while everything else uses the statute mile.

5

Assuming a decimal foot

Construction measurements are usually feet and inches, not decimal feet. 6.5 feet is 6 feet 6 inches, but 6 feet 5 inches is 6.417 feet, and reading one as the other is a five-centimetre error.

Who Uses Which System

Three countries have not formally adopted the metric system as their primary standard: the United States, Liberia and Myanmar. That statistic gets repeated more often than it gets qualified.

In practice the United States runs on both. Science, medicine, the military and most manufacturing are metric. Nutrition labels are metric. Car engines are specified in litres. What remains imperial is largely consumer-facing: road signs, weather, body measurements, construction lumber and cooking.

The United Kingdom is similarly mixed, and formally so. Road distances are in miles, draught beer is in pints, and milk can be sold in pints, while nearly everything else is metric by law. Someone will give their height in feet and inches and their weight in stones, then buy 500 grams of cheese.

This is why conversion tools stay useful. The question is rarely which system is better; it is that any given document, spec sheet or recipe may use either, and often both.
